Amagi API 文档 - v6.1.2
    正在准备搜索索引...

    接口 IBoundBilibiliFetcher

    绑定了 Cookie 的 B站 Fetcher 接口 调用方法时无需传递 cookie 参数

    interface IBoundBilibiliFetcher {
        fetchVideoInfo: BoundMethodOverload<
            BilibiliVideoInfoOptions,
            BiliOneWork_V0,
        >;
        fetchVideoStreamUrl: BoundMethodOverload<
            BilibiliVideoStreamOptions,
            BiliVideoPlayurlIsLogin_V0
            | BiliBiliVideoPlayurlNoLogin_V0,
        >;
        fetchVideoDanmaku: BoundMethodOverload<
            BilibiliDanmakuOptions,
            BiliProtobufDanmaku_V0,
        >;
        fetchComments: BoundMethodOverload<
            BilibiliCommentsOptions,
            BiliWorkComments_V0,
        >;
        fetchCommentReplies: BoundMethodOverload<
            BilibiliCommentRepliesOptions,
            BiliCommentReply_V0,
        >;
        fetchUserCard: BoundMethodOverload<BilibiliUserOptions, BiliUserProfile_V0>;
        fetchUserDynamicList: BoundMethodOverload<
            BilibiliUserOptions,
            BiliUserDynamic,
        >;
        fetchUserSpaceInfo: BoundMethodOverload<
            BilibiliUserOptions,
            UserSpaceInfo_V0,
        >;
        fetchUploaderTotalViews: BoundMethodOverload<
            BilibiliUserOptions,
            BiliUserFullView_V0,
        >;
        fetchDynamicDetail: BoundMethodOverload<
            BilibiliDynamicOptions,
            BiliDynamicInfoUnion,
        >;
        fetchDynamicCard: BoundMethodOverload<BilibiliDynamicOptions, ErrorResult>;
        fetchBangumiInfo: BoundMethodOverload<
            BilibiliBangumiInfoOptions,
            BiliBangumiVideoInfo_V0,
        >;
        fetchBangumiStreamUrl: BoundMethodOverload<
            BilibiliBangumiStreamOptions,
            BiliBangumiVideoPlayurlIsLogin_V0
            | BiliBangumiVideoPlayurlNoLogin_V0,
        >;
        fetchLiveRoomInfo: BoundMethodOverload<
            BilibiliLiveRoomOptions,
            BiliLiveRoomDetail_V0,
        >;
        fetchLiveRoomInitInfo: BoundMethodOverload<
            BilibiliLiveRoomOptions,
            BiliLiveRoomDef_V0,
        >;
        fetchArticleContent: BoundMethodOverload<
            BilibiliArticleOptions,
            ArticleContent_V0,
        >;
        fetchArticleCards: BoundMethodOverload<
            BilibiliArticleCardOptions,
            ArticleCard_V0,
        >;
        fetchArticleInfo: BoundMethodOverload<
            BilibiliArticleOptions,
            ArticleInfo_V0,
        >;
        fetchArticleListInfo: BoundMethodOverload<
            BilibiliArticleOptions,
            ColumnInfo_V0,
        >;
        fetchLoginStatus: BoundNoParamMethodOverload<any>;
        requestLoginQrcode: BoundNoParamMethodOverload<BiliNewLoginQrcode_V0>;
        checkQrcodeStatus: BoundMethodOverload<
            BilibiliQrcodeStatusOptions,
            BiliCheckQrcode_V0,
        >;
        requestCaptchaFromVoucher: BoundMethodOverload<
            BilibiliApplyCaptchaOptions,
            ApplyCaptcha_V0,
        >;
        validateCaptchaResult: BoundMethodOverload<
            BilibiliValidateCaptchaOptions,
            ValidateCaptcha_V0,
        >;
        convertAvToBv: BoundMethodOverload<BilibiliAv2BvOptions, BiliAv2Bv_V0>;
        convertBvToAv: BoundMethodOverload<BilibiliBv2AvOptions, BiliBv2AV_V0>;
        fetchEmojiList: BoundNoParamMethodOverload<BiliEmojiList_V0>;
    }
    索引

    属性

    fetchVideoInfo: BoundMethodOverload<BilibiliVideoInfoOptions, BiliOneWork_V0>

    获取B站视频详细信息

    fetchVideoStreamUrl: BoundMethodOverload<
        BilibiliVideoStreamOptions,
        BiliVideoPlayurlIsLogin_V0
        | BiliBiliVideoPlayurlNoLogin_V0,
    >

    获取B站视频流地址

    fetchVideoDanmaku: BoundMethodOverload<
        BilibiliDanmakuOptions,
        BiliProtobufDanmaku_V0,
    >

    获取B站视频实时弹幕

    fetchComments: BoundMethodOverload<BilibiliCommentsOptions, BiliWorkComments_V0>

    获取B站视频/动态评论列表

    fetchCommentReplies: BoundMethodOverload<
        BilibiliCommentRepliesOptions,
        BiliCommentReply_V0,
    >

    获取B站指定评论的回复列表

    fetchUserCard: BoundMethodOverload<BilibiliUserOptions, BiliUserProfile_V0>

    获取B站用户名片信息

    fetchUserDynamicList: BoundMethodOverload<BilibiliUserOptions, BiliUserDynamic>

    获取B站用户动态列表

    fetchUserSpaceInfo: BoundMethodOverload<BilibiliUserOptions, UserSpaceInfo_V0>

    获取B站用户空间详细信息

    fetchUploaderTotalViews: BoundMethodOverload<
        BilibiliUserOptions,
        BiliUserFullView_V0,
    >

    获取B站 UP 主总播放量

    fetchDynamicDetail: BoundMethodOverload<
        BilibiliDynamicOptions,
        BiliDynamicInfoUnion,
    >

    获取B站动态详情

    fetchDynamicCard: BoundMethodOverload<BilibiliDynamicOptions, ErrorResult>

    获取B站动态卡片信息

    v6.1.3 已废弃,B站官方已于 2025-08-09 删除原 dynamic_svr 接口。 调用将返回错误信息 计划于 v7.0.0 移除。

    fetchBangumiInfo: BoundMethodOverload<
        BilibiliBangumiInfoOptions,
        BiliBangumiVideoInfo_V0,
    >

    获取B站番剧基本信息

    fetchBangumiStreamUrl: BoundMethodOverload<
        BilibiliBangumiStreamOptions,
        BiliBangumiVideoPlayurlIsLogin_V0
        | BiliBangumiVideoPlayurlNoLogin_V0,
    >

    获取B站番剧视频流地址

    fetchLiveRoomInfo: BoundMethodOverload<
        BilibiliLiveRoomOptions,
        BiliLiveRoomDetail_V0,
    >

    获取B站直播间信息

    fetchLiveRoomInitInfo: BoundMethodOverload<
        BilibiliLiveRoomOptions,
        BiliLiveRoomDef_V0,
    >

    获取B站直播间初始化信息

    fetchArticleContent: BoundMethodOverload<
        BilibiliArticleOptions,
        ArticleContent_V0,
    >

    获取B站专栏正文内容

    fetchArticleCards: BoundMethodOverload<
        BilibiliArticleCardOptions,
        ArticleCard_V0,
    >

    获取B站专栏卡片信息

    fetchArticleInfo: BoundMethodOverload<BilibiliArticleOptions, ArticleInfo_V0>

    获取B站专栏文章基本信息

    fetchArticleListInfo: BoundMethodOverload<BilibiliArticleOptions, ColumnInfo_V0>

    获取B站文集基本信息

    fetchLoginStatus: BoundNoParamMethodOverload<any>

    获取B站登录状态信息

    requestLoginQrcode: BoundNoParamMethodOverload<BiliNewLoginQrcode_V0>

    申请B站登录二维码

    checkQrcodeStatus: BoundMethodOverload<
        BilibiliQrcodeStatusOptions,
        BiliCheckQrcode_V0,
    >

    检查B站登录二维码扫描状态

    requestCaptchaFromVoucher: BoundMethodOverload<
        BilibiliApplyCaptchaOptions,
        ApplyCaptcha_V0,
    >

    从 v_voucher 申请验证码

    validateCaptchaResult: BoundMethodOverload<
        BilibiliValidateCaptchaOptions,
        ValidateCaptcha_V0,
    >

    验证验证码结果

    convertAvToBv: BoundMethodOverload<BilibiliAv2BvOptions, BiliAv2Bv_V0>

    将 AV 号转换为 BV 号

    convertBvToAv: BoundMethodOverload<BilibiliBv2AvOptions, BiliBv2AV_V0>

    将 BV 号转换为 AV 号

    fetchEmojiList: BoundNoParamMethodOverload<BiliEmojiList_V0>

    获取B站表情包列表